Just a quick help on the palette stuff (I've forgotten most of it myself.)

The colour numbers that I'm referring to are placed on the screen as such:
(On Ctrl-F12)

Colour 0                Colour 7                Colour 14
Colour 1                Colour 8                Colour 15
Colour 2                Colour 9
Colour 3                Colour 10               (Preset stuff.)
Colour 4                Colour 11
Colour 5                Colour 12
Colour 6                Colour 13

To save the palette, you'll have to use the "Save all Preferences" button
in the Song Variables & Directory Configuration page (F12)

Uses of the colours: (This is the part which I can't remember anymore :) )
 Colour 0:
   Border colour.
   Background for 'empty' windows.
   Lots of text

 Colour 1:
   "Back" of border colour
   Colour for .MTM and .MOD files.
   Colour of samples of unidentified format.
   Colour channel headers in the pattern editor & info page.
   Secondary colour on the info page.

 Colour 2:
   Background Colour.
   Colour of scroll bars, text entry
   Color of effects/effectvalues on infopage.

 Colour 3:
   Hilight colour.
   Sometimes used as the heading colour
   "Fore" of border colour
   Colour of IT modules and samples whose formats have been identified.

 Colour 4:
   Error colour (in load/save routines)

 Colour 5:
   Colour of header information
   Colour of real-time volume bars on infopage.
   Colour of directories in sample list.

 Colour 6:
   Colour of text in help page, pattern editor, sample list, instrument list.
   Colour of unchecked files.
   Primary colour on the infopage.

 Colour 7:
   Colour of dimmed entries in help list.
   Colour of note-off semicolon on the infopage.
   Colour of unidentified modules.

 Colour 8:
   Block colour when row doesn't coincide with row hilight

 Colour 9:
   Block colour when row coincides with row hilights

 Colour 10:
   Small character colour
    (when using the track views, or the 36 channel view on the infopage)

 Colour 11:
   Startup logo colour.
   Colour of playback mark

 Colour 12:
   Volume Envelope colour.
   Message editor colour.

 Colour 13:
   Waveform colour in sample list.

 Colour 14:
   Block hilight major.

 Colour 15:
   Block hilight minor.
